The cache is hidden approx 1 mile from the village of Welton along Welton Dale.
Park in the attractive village of Welton which has all the attributes of a Yorkshire village, good pub, pretty church and a popular duck pond. It also has the claim to fame that Dick Turpin once drank there and then was arrested in nearby Brough having shot dead a chicken after an argument !
If you wish to park as close to cache location, park along Dale road
( 53'44.1575 N 000'32.7380 W ). At the end of Dale road continue along the track past the impressive large duck pond and through the kissing gate at the end. The track gently inclines flanked on the left by thickly planted coniferous trees. The cache lies along this track if the sheep havent got there first ...
